Stallions Finish on the Podium at SHSID Table Tennis Tournament
On May 24, Shanghai High School International Division (SHSID) Table Tennis Team participated in the SSSA (Shanghai Schools Sports Association) Table Tennis U15 Boys & Girls Tournament. Held at SHSID, the competition welcomed strong teams from many schools.

The tournament used the 11-point game with three rounds, with each player serves two consecutive balls before switching. The Stallions were confident and ready to face their challenges.

In U15 Boys, SHSID boys brought impressive power to the field, matching every challenge with upbeat confidence and razor-sharp focus. Even though their competitors are fierce, SHSID boys still managed to perform their best skills. In the final match of the singles, two of the SHSID boys faced each other, contending for the championship. Ultimately, with full effort, the boys won the gold and silver medal in both singles and doubles.

The U15 Girls Team had an exceptional performance throughout the tournament. All girls reached to the knockout round and four of them reached to the semi-final round, swept up all the medals for girls singles. The girls also were awarded the gold and silver medals for doubles.

SHSID U15 table tennis team excelled at the tournament, securing multiple podium finishes through
exceptional skill, teamwork, and sportsmanship. Their collective success reflected rigorous training and dedicated coaching. Well done!
